Difference Between Paas And Saas

Once the deal is inked, the client gains secure online access to the services they’ve paid for within a few hours. Just like other ‘as a Service’ solutions, PaaS is consumed on a pay-as-you-go basis. Each cloud model offers specific features and functionalities, and it is crucial for your organization to understand the differences.

High-quality user interfaces and a low adoption learning curve mean that SaaS is ready to go when a business need arises. Additionally, a wide scope for customization means that SaaS what is iaas can be built to meet the needs of specific industries, as required. An active network connection and a compatible endpoint are all it takes to ensure seamless operations using SaaS.

What is Software as a Service (SaaS)

Software as a Service, also known as cloud application services, represents the most commonly utilized option for businesses in the cloud market. SaaS utilizes the internet to deliver applications, which are managed by a third-party vendor, to its users. A majority of SaaS applications run directly through your web browser, which means they do not require any downloads or installations on the client side.
difference between paas and saas
As a rule of thumb, enterprise-level companies can spend far more than small businesses, individual company owners, or regular consumers. There’s a reason that so many SaaS companies have a custom price tier for larger customers. This suggests low concern and frequent purchases of additional products or services.

SaaS Disadvantages

Finally, software-as-a-service solution gives the client or customer direct access to pre-build applications and solutions which they can use to rapidly deploy sites and apps. The technicalities are taken care of, and there isn’t the need — nor, in most cases, the possibility —  for developers to delve into the code and customize the solution. With platform-as-a-service or PaaS, the vendor gives its clients or customers the same server space and flexibility, but with some additional tools to help build or customize applications more rapidly.
difference between paas and saas
This can be anything from going out of business to finding a competitor offering similar services at a lower price. Remember, being below 100% doesn’t necessarily mean the company is taking a loss, only that it has higher churn. Churn is more common with small businesses and tends to flatten out as a company grows, and its software becomes more mature. Similarly, using NRR focuses on quality upsells rather than trying to sell anything to anyone.

PaaS Pros, Cons and Use Cases

Gone are the days when you had to purchase CDs/DVDs (or floppy disks if you are as old as us) and load heavy software onto your computers. Or pay for expensive data centers and servers to develop your customized applications. A lot has changed in the business world with the growth of cloud computing services in recent years. SaaS (sometimes called cloud application services) is cloud-hosted, ready-to-use application software. Users pay a monthly or annual fee to use a complete application from within a web browser, desktop client or mobile app. The application and all of the infrastructure required to deliver it – servers, storage, networking, middleware, application software, data storage – are hosted and managed by the SaaS vendor.

Income from new customers can fluctuate wildly, but a company with a steady NRR over time is much more attractive to investors. The consumer is responsible for knowing the rules and regulations that apply to their industry and how that might affect or interact with the desired SaaS product. Failure to be compliant would be on the consumer’s hands if they did not do their due diligence in research. Again, though a product may sound perfect, if it does not meet the security standards required by particular industries, a consumer will bump into those limitations.

Employees only need to use a set of credentials to access the platform or software. Once this is done, they can begin work immediately in a cloud environment with no need for additional deployment or maintenance measures. By choosing these cloud-based solutions, corporations enjoy minimum expenses and maximum simplicity in terms of deployment. There is no need to provision or manage software licenses, compatible hardware, and other IT infrastructure. Whether it’s the latest software for use in day-to-day operations or a cutting-edge development platform required for a specific, short-term project, it can be deployed and ready for use within a few hours. PaaS and SaaS can even be deployed together to create a full-capacity business environment for any organization, securely, swiftly, and at scale.

  • The best-known SaaS solutions vendors are Google Apps, Dropbox, Gmail, Salesforce, Cisco WebEx, Concur, GoToMeeting, Office365.
  • The cloud refers to how and where data is stored — perhaps more importantly, where it isn’t.
  • Becoming a cloud developer requires you to be proficient in traditional programming skills and attain specialized knowledge in one of the prominent cloud platform development environments.
  • “IaaS sits at the very bottom of the stack [and] is all about the virtualization of your core network infrastructure like data center servers and storage,” he began.
  • However, providers of the IaaS manage the servers, hard drives, networking, virtualization, and storage.

Other key benefits of PaaS include transparency, flexible pricing, swift and hassle-free deployment, robust business continuity, and on-demand scalability. As ‘work from home’ measures continue to see increasing popularity in 2021, PaaS and SaaS solutions are being adopted because of their instant, hassle-free deployment. More and more enterprises are using PaaS and SaaS to access hardware and software resources remotely and on-demand. Our as-a-service solutions are open source and backed by our award-winning support and more than 25 years of experience and collaborative innovation. With Red Hat, you can arrange your people, processes, and technologies to build, deploy, and manage apps that are ready for the cloud—and the future. PaaS is a way that developers can create a framework to build and customize their web-based applications on.